The Great Backyard Bird Count

Photo by Lip Kee

Have you participated in the Great Backyard Bird Count before? This is a great opportunity to teach your kids about birds (and maybe learn a little bit yourself!), build a bird feeder and just get outside and play.

Check out the Bird Source website for more information on how to participate in your own backyard. There are also a few events in the area to check out. You can even print out a neat participation certificate for your kids.

Easy Bird Feeder

I've been wanting to make a pine cone (or pie corn as Finley calls them!) bird feeder with Finley for the past few weeks but every time we go out for a walk all I find is soggy, wet pine cones. (Not really a surprise, it's October in the northwest after all.)

I was pretty excited when I found this on Pinterest this morning. Yeah!

Bird seed? Check! Natural peanut butter (only the best for these birdies!)? Check! Paper towel roll? Check! (Well, check after I took all the paper towels off the roll. Note to self - keep the toilet paper and paper towel rolls instead of recycling them!)

Let's get to it...

Slather on that PB!

Do a taste test just to make sure the birds are going to like it.

Roll away...

And roll some more.

The best part? No string required! Just put it right on a tree branch!
